Bulgogi (Grilled marinated Beef) Recip

Ingredients

2 lb Beef (loin tip steak)*, thin sliced

3 Green onions, sliced in a bias

4 Button mushrooms, sliced

1/2 Onion, thinly sliced

1/4 cup Soy sauce, 1/4 cup sugar, 1/4 cup water

2 tbsp Sesame oil, 2 tsp pepper

1 tsp Sesame seeds, 1-2 tbsp minced garlic

1 tbsp Juice of ginger

1/2 Onion, grind in a food processor

(*Or any parts for grilling)

Preparation

Combine all ingredients in a big bowl.

Marinade beef and vegetables for at least 30 minutes.

1-2 hours is the best, after more than several hours it will taste too salty.

Grill the beef.

Serve with rice.

Cook's Notes

Tips: Important tip is to use same amount of soy sauce and sugar. If you do this a day ahead, reduce soy sauce. And don't forget to put it in a refrigerator. Ask a butcher to slice the beef very thinly. Traditionally, bul go ki made with very thin slice of beef. But store bought beef, rather thick slice works as well. Or there's a sliced beef just for bul go ki in a Korean grocery. You can grill this on a table top, with a shallow pan. Grill with medium high heat and have the juice of beef and vegetables on rice.
